Buying Guide for the Best Skiing Masks

Choosing the right skiing mask is crucial for ensuring comfort, visibility, and protection while you're out on the slopes. A good skiing mask will protect your face from the cold, wind, and sun, while also providing clear vision and a comfortable fit. When selecting a skiing mask, consider the following key specifications to find the best fit for your needs.
MaterialThe material of a skiing mask is important because it affects comfort, breathability, and warmth. Common materials include fleece, neoprene, and synthetic blends. Fleece is soft and warm, making it ideal for very cold conditions. Neoprene is more durable and provides good wind protection, but may not be as breathable. Synthetic blends often offer a balance of warmth, breathability, and moisture-wicking properties. Choose a material based on the typical weather conditions you'll be skiing in and your personal comfort preferences.
Fit and SizeA proper fit is essential for comfort and effectiveness. Skiing masks come in various sizes and designs to accommodate different face shapes and sizes. Some masks have adjustable features like straps or drawstrings to ensure a snug fit. A mask that is too tight can be uncomfortable and restrict breathing, while one that is too loose may not provide adequate protection. Try on different masks to find one that fits well without being too restrictive, and consider masks with adjustable features for a customizable fit.
VentilationVentilation is crucial to prevent fogging and ensure breathability. Good ventilation allows moisture and warm air to escape, reducing the risk of fogging on your goggles and keeping you comfortable. Look for masks with built-in vents or breathable panels, especially if you tend to overheat or ski in milder conditions. If you often ski in very cold weather, you might prioritize warmth over ventilation, but still ensure there is some airflow to prevent fogging.
UV ProtectionUV protection is important to shield your skin from harmful ultraviolet rays, which can be intense at high altitudes and on sunny days. Some skiing masks come with built-in UV protection, which can help prevent sunburn and long-term skin damage. If you frequently ski in sunny conditions, look for masks that offer UV protection to keep your skin safe.
Moisture-WickingMoisture-wicking properties help keep your face dry by drawing sweat away from your skin. This is important for maintaining comfort and preventing chafing or irritation. Masks made from moisture-wicking materials are especially beneficial if you tend to sweat a lot or ski in warmer conditions. Check the product description for mentions of moisture-wicking technology or materials like polyester blends.
Compatibility with Goggles and HelmetsEnsuring your skiing mask is compatible with your goggles and helmet is essential for a seamless fit and optimal performance. Some masks are designed to fit comfortably under helmets and work well with goggles, preventing gaps that can let in cold air or snow. When trying on masks, wear your goggles and helmet to check for compatibility and comfort. Look for masks with features like flat seams or low-profile designs that minimize bulk and ensure a good fit with your other gear.
